Abstract
I illustrate the role of infrared renormalons in computing inclusive B-decay spectra. I explain the relation between the leading ambiguity in the definition of Sudakov form factor \sim \exp(N\Lambda/M) and that of the pole mass, and show how these ambiguities cancel out between the perturbative and non-perturbative components of the b-quark distribution in the meson.
